Nazgulled 11 Posted March 29, 2016 Posted March 29, 2016 I might be the odd one in that I prefer titles named "The Something" to be sorted under "T" and not under "S". Currently, Emby does nothing to sort title unless it comes from the .nfo file or some metadata provider. I usually have .nfos for all movies and Emby reads from those (falling back to metadata downloaders if needed). They usually don't contain a "sort name". This is a request to include a feature (a checkbox in the metadata configuration) to automatically fill the "sort name" field with the exact same title from the "name" field. That's it. I understand if this is not something you want to add, but here's hoping you do Thanks for listening.
Solution bluemonkey07 590 Posted March 29, 2016 Solution Posted March 29, 2016 (edited) There is a .xml file you can edit to change this See here : http://emby.media/community/index.php?/topic/9612-Change-sort-order-to-not-ignore-prefix? Edited March 29, 2016 by Vidman 4
